Mystery boxes are a popular feature in video games and mobile apps. Players can purchase a virtual loot boxes which contain items such as rare items and in-game bonuses. These boxes are often designed to be addicting, and can cause people to spend lots of money for in-game currency or real-world cash.
The underlying theory behind mystery boxes is simple: They trigger the release dopamine, which is neurotransmitter. The brain is able to be rewarded and to feel joy. This is the reason why many people to purchase these boxes and the fact that they can contain anything from an ordinary item to an unusual or unique one makes them more attractive. In recent years, stores have begun to offer customized mystery boxes that are tailored to individual buyers' interests. For instance, Stitch Fix and Trunk Club provide mystery boxes based on clothing whose contents are hand-picked by a stylist in accordance with the customer's style preferences.
